Exemple #1
0
        /// <summary>
        /// Webs the ticket status to biz ticket status.
        /// </summary>
        /// <param name="DataTicketStatus">The data ticket status.</param>
        /// <returns>BizTicketStatus.</returns>
        public static BizTicketStatus WebTicketStatusToBizTicketStatus(this WebTicketStatus DataTicketStatus)
        {
            BizTicketStatus bizTicketStatus = new BizTicketStatus
            {
                Id         = DataTicketStatus.Id,
                StatusName = DataTicketStatus.StatusName,
                Active     = DataTicketStatus.Active,
            };

            return(bizTicketStatus);
        }
Exemple #2
0
        /// <summary>
        /// Bizs the ticket status to web ticket status.
        /// </summary>
        /// <param name="DataTicketStatus">The data ticket status.</param>
        /// <returns>WebTicketStatus.</returns>
        public static WebTicketStatus BizTicketStatusToWebTicketStatus(this BizTicketStatus DataTicketStatus)
        {
            WebTicketStatus webTicketStatus = new WebTicketStatus
            {
                Id         = DataTicketStatus.Id,
                StatusName = DataTicketStatus.StatusName,
                Active     = DataTicketStatus.Active,
            };

            return(webTicketStatus);
        }
        public IHttpActionResult Delete(WebTicketStatus webTicketStatus)
        {
            string response = crudFuction.BizDeleteTicketStatus(webTicketStatus.WebTicketStatusToBizTicketStatus());

            if (!response.Equals("EXITO"))
            {
                return(BadRequest(response));
            }
            else
            {
                return(Ok(response));
            }
        }